Pathology salary in New York

What pathology pay in New York looks like before and after tax, and what it's worth once local prices are accounted for.

Annual mean

$309,660

+8.5% vs national mean

Est. take-home

$202,322

After federal + FICA + state tax

Adjusted for prices

$187,509

Price level 107.9 (US=100)

On adjusted take-home, New York ranks #21 of 33 states for pathology. See the full ranking →

Wage: U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ics (OEWS), May 2025 — “Physicians, Pathologists” (May 2025). Take-home is an estimate for a single filer taking the standard deduction (federal + FICA + state income tax, wages only; state brackets from Tax Foundation) — not tax advice. Price level: U.S. Bureau of Economic Analysis, Regional Price Parities (2024), US average = 100. Wages cover all employment settings and exclude many self-employed/partnership physicians; individual offers vary widely. VitalPost shows sourced public data for context only.
